Pagini recente » Cod sursa (job #2277999) | Cod sursa (job #3003605) | Cod sursa (job #1830506) | Cod sursa (job #2393151) | Cod sursa (job #1025054)
#include <iostream>
#include <fstream>
using namespace std;
int cmmdc(int a, int b)
{
int m , cm;
if( a < b ) {
m = a;
}else{
m = b ;
}
for ( int i=1 ;i <= m ; i++){
if ( (a % i == 0 ) && ( b % i == 0 ) ) {
cm = i ;
}
}
return cm;
}
int main(void)
{
int a , b, c ;
ifstream f("euclid2.in");
ofstream g("euclid2.out");
f >> c ;
for(int i=1;i<=c;i++){
f >> a; f>> b;
g << cmmdc(a,b)<<"\n";
}
f.close();
g.close();
return 0;
}